Can you recommend the best sailing novels for beginners?

1 answer
2024-11-04 17:35

A good option is also 'Captains Courageous' by Rudyard Kipling. It tells the story of a spoiled boy who has to learn the ways of the sea. The sailing parts are well - written and it gives a good introduction to the life on a ship and the values of the sailors.

Can you recommend the best fiction sailing books for beginners?

2 answers
2024-10-29 17:16

For beginners, 'Swallows and Amazons' is a great start. It's easy to read and has a lot of fun sailing adventures that kids and new readers will enjoy. Another good one is 'The Old Man and the Sea'. It's a short read but has a powerful message about the sea and sailing. Also, 'Captains Courageous' can be a good choice as it gives a simple yet engaging look at life on a sailing ship.

Can you recommend some best sailing books fiction for beginners?

3 answers
2024-11-10 14:42

'The Old Man and the Sea' by Ernest Hemingway is a good start. It's a simple yet powerful story about an old fisherman's struggle at sea. It gives a great sense of the relationship between a man and the ocean while sailing.
